From: Marc-André Lureau <[email protected]> Replace the custom audio logging infrastructure (dolog macro and AUD_log/AUD_vlog) with standard QEMU error reporting (error_report, error_printf, error_vprintf).
Note that we also dropped the abort() call in DEBUG_AUDIO, as it is not usually compiled with, doesn't help much, and can easily be added back when doing development as needed.
